Because these are nature-focused explorations, comfortable footwear is absolutely essential. We recommend sturdy trainers or walking shoes that you're already used to wearing – blisters are the last thing you want on a fantastic tour! Layering your clothing is also key; Manchester weather can be unpredictable, and short tours don’t allow for lengthy changes.
